Dealing with Clogged or Dirty Components

Pump filters and screens are constantly subjected to dirt, debris, and mineral deposits. Over time, these elements build up, choking water flow and stressing pump motors. Clogged filters can feel like trying to breathe through a straw—definitely not a recommended approach for machinery or people.

Cleaning or replacing these components often restores smooth operation. Repair professionals bring the right tools and know-how to flush out blockages without causing damage. Sometimes, sediment buildup inside pipes requires gentle attention to avoid disruptions further downstream.

Mechanical Wear and Tear on Moving Parts

Irrigation pumps endure a lot of movement, and wear on parts like impellers, bearings, and seals can cause trouble. A worn impeller won’t push water as effectively, while damaged seals may lead to leaks that sap pressure and efficiency. Bearings that squeak or grind warn that parts may be running dry or misaligned.

Electrical Issues That Stall Pump Performance

Pumps powered by electric motors can face their own unique challenges. Faulty wiring, motor overheating, or failed capacitors might cause pumps to stall or run intermittently. Electrical components exposed to moisture or dirt tend to fail prematurely if left unchecked.

Technicians trained in electrical diagnostics step in with meters and test equipment to pinpoint trouble spots. Rewiring, component replacement, or motor servicing falls within their wheelhouse. Overheating and Its Effects on Pumps

Pumps working overtime or operating under harsh environmental conditions can suffer from overheating. Heat strains motors and seals, accelerating wear and risking catastrophic failures. Overheated pumps may emit burning smells or shut down unexpectedly.

Repair experts often recommend cooling solutions or operational adjustments to help pumps breathe easier. Checking for proper ventilation, verifying motor ratings, and installing protective devices can all play a role in reducing heat stress.

Pressure Fluctuations and Flow Irregularities

Inconsistent pressure or fluctuating flow rates spell trouble for irrigation efficiency. Pumps may cycle on and off too frequently or fail to maintain steady output, causing watering schedules to falter.

The culprit might lie in malfunctioning pressure switches, faulty valves, or air trapped in the system. Repair technicians diagnose these flow irregularities by testing system components and pressure readings. Replacing defective switches, bleeding air pockets, and adjusting valves bring water delivery back into balance.

Leaking Seals and Their Impact on Efficiency

Seals form a critical barrier that keeps water contained within pump chambers. When seals wear out or crack, leaks develop, sapping pressure and increasing energy consumption. Water escaping through faulty seals may damage surrounding equipment or create slippery hazards around the pump site.

Professionals replace worn seals with durable materials matched to pump specifications. Their precise installation prevents future leaks and extends pump life. Spotting a leaking seal early on often prevents more expensive repairs down the line.

Vibration and Noise as Indicators of Underlying Problems

Excessive vibration or unusual noises often hint at misaligned shafts, loose components, or imbalanced impellers. Pumps don’t enjoy dance parties that involve shaking and rattling—such behavior signals that something inside the unit requires immediate attention.

Repair teams use vibration analyzers and sound detection tools to trace problems to their source. Tightening bolts, realigning shafts, or balancing rotating parts calms the pump down, leading to quieter operation and less wear.
